E–Yount (5), Lopes (3), Hancock (1), Gross (4), Phillips (15). DP–Oakland 1. 2B–Milwaukee Moore (10,off Conroy); Gantner (7,off Keough). HR–Milwaukee Yost (3,4th inning off Conroy 0 on, 1 out), Oakland Lopes (5,2nd inning off Augustine 1 on, 1 out). SH–Yost (5,off Conroy); Kearney (3,off Easterly); Murphy (4,off Easterly). SF–Simmons (3,off Conroy); Murphy (2,off Porter); Kearney (1,off Porter). IBB–Oglivie (6,by Keough); Lopes (1,by Easterly). HBP–Gross (1,by Easterly). SB–Yount (5,2nd base off Keough/Kearney); Phillips (5,2nd base off Porter/Yost); Almon (8,Home off Easterly/Yost); Davis (15,2nd base off Easterly/Yost). CS–Yount (2,2nd base by Conroy/Kearney); Page (2,3rd base by Easterly/Yost). HBP–Easterly (1,Gross). IBB–Easterly (1,Lopes); Keough (1,Oglivie). U-HP–Drew Coble, 1B–John Shulock, 2B–Derryl Cousins, 3B–Don Denkinger. T–3:15. A–12,198. |
